Wax Trax! Records is back: Legendary label resurrected by co-founder’s daughter

The legendary Wax Trax! Records imprint will be reborn this summer under the direction of Julia Nash — daughter of label co-founder Jim Nash — and will mark its resurrection with the release of a 12-inch single from Cocksure, the new project featuring label mainstay Chris Connelly and Acumen Nation’s Jason Novak.

A Split-Second to play first U.S. show in 25 years this December in New York City

Belgian EBM/New Beat outfit A Split-Second — a member of the hugely influential Wax Trax! Records stable in the late ’80s — will make a rare live appearance in New York City this December in what’s being billed as the group’s first U.S. appearance in about a quarter-century.

Chris Connelly, Paul Barker reunite as Bells Into Machines — hear 3 brand-new tracks

Singer Chris Connelly and bassist/programmer Paul Barker — who played together in Ministry, Revolting Cocks, Pigface and various other Wax Trax! Records industrial-rock supergroups in the late ’80s and early ’90s — are writing and recording new music together as Bells Into Machines.

Wax Trax! Records documentary to chronicle ‘rise and fall’ of legendary record label

Fans still waiting for the long-promised DVD of 2011’s Wax Trax! Records Retrospectacle: 33⅓ Year Anniversary concert got good and bad news this week: While the concert film still isn’t finished, a new documentary is in the works that promises to chronicle the “rise and fall of Wax Trax! Records.”

My Life With the Thrill Kill Kult map out 25th anniversary tour of U.S. this fall

Wax Trax!-era industrial rockers My Life With the Thrill Kill Kult will embark on a seven-week tour of the U.K. this fall to mark their 25th anniversary, a trek dubbed Back From Beyond! that also will find the group performing tracks off the upcoming debut from Bomb Gang Girlz, Thrill Kill Kult’s long-running group of backing singers.

‘Sound Opinions’ to salute Wax Trax! Records with RevCo’s Chris Connelly, Paul Barker

This week’s episode of the ‘Sound Opinions’ radio show — billed as ‘the world’s only rock ‘n’ roll talk show’ — will look back at the legacy of Wax Trax! Records and will feature an interview with former Revolting Cocks and Ministry members Chris Connelly and Paul Barker.
